WebPDF WAC 296-131-020 Meals and rest periods. (1) Every employee employed more than five hours shall receive a meal period of at least thirty minutes. WebJul 1, 2008 · Meals with Meetings 70.15.10 July 1, 2008 Reimbursement for meals with meetings 70.15.10.a RCW 43.03.050(3) provides for reimbursement for meals, for certain business meetings (includes conferences, conventions, and formal training sessions) involving elective and appointive officials and state employees. WebOct 31, 2016 · The Open Public Meetings Act (“OPMA”), chapter 42.30 RCW, was passed by the Legislature in 1971 as a part of a nationwide effort to make government affairs more open, accessible and responsive. WebFeb 24, 2024 · WASHINGTON — The Internal Revenue Service issued proposed regulations on the business expense deduction for meals and entertainment following changes made by the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act (TCJA). The 2024 TCJA eliminated the deduction for any expenses related to activities generally considered entertainment, amusement or recreation.
